Heron's formula is easiest as it "requires no arbitrary choice of side as base or vertex as origin, contrary to other formulas for the area of a triangle:" A = s ( s − a) ( s − b) ( s − c) where s = p / 2 is half of the perimeter p = a + b + c (called the semiperimeter of the triangle).
